Overview:

Food & Beverage Manager is responsible for overseeing the execution/service of all catered & concessions events. The Food & Beverage Manager must be personable and able to work in an ever-changing fast-paced environment. The Food & Beverage Manager will be responsible for training and developing all service staff.  

 

This role pays an annual salary of $60,000-$70,000

 

Benefits for Full-Time roles: Health, Dental and Vision Insurance, 401(k) Savings Plan, 401(k) matching, and Paid Time Off (vacation days, sick days, and 11 holidays).

Responsibilities:
  • Overall management of catering and concessions food and beverage operations, including interviewing, hiring, scheduling, ordering, inventory, labor costs, and equipment maintenance.
  • Ensure legal, efficient, professional, and profitable operation of the venue.
  • Generate and review financial reports, including budgets, projections, forecasting, revenue analysis, disbursements, capital investments, labor and product costs, wage and salary control, and P&L financial statements.
  • Conflict resolution; last-resort mediation; arbitration and labor negotiations, when applicable.
  • Responsible for overseeing the serving of meals to guests or directing guests to the buffet line.
  • Responsible for overseeing serving beverages to guests, including alcoholic beverages.
  • Check the guest's ID to verify the minimum age requirement for the purchase of alcoholic beverages.
  • Responsible for observing guests to respond to any additional requests and determine when the meal has been completed.
  • Responsible for executing all directives stated in all banquet event orders.
  • Responsible for completion and updating of administrative paperwork associated with events, i.e., diagrams, timelines, and side-work assignments.
  • Responsible for ensuring tableware and linens are replaced as necessary.
  • Identify ingredients or explain how various items on the menu are prepared.
  • Assists in setting up banquet functions including linens, dishware, glassware, and silverware.
  • Responsible for observing guests to respond to any additional requests and determine them before, during, or after the served meal.
  • Maintains sanitation, health, and safety standards in work areas.
  • Show demonstrated ability to meet the company standard for excellent attendance.
  • Assures that the location equipment is operable and clean prior to the start of the event.
  • Responsible for recognizing guests that are visibly intoxicated and taking action to cut off alcohol to such individuals.
  • Manages F&B team and oversees projects including training, inventory, and special events.
  • Manages the Concessions Department and supervises outlets when business demands it.
  • Maintains up-to-date knowledge of Union Contract contents.
  • Enforces all Oak View Group policies and procedures.
  • All other duties as assigned by the Asst. General Manager and General Manager.
Qualifications:
  • 3-5 years of experience working in a management capacity in a high-volume, fast-paced restaurant or catering environment. Ability to supervise the work of others.
  • Associate's degree in business management or hospitality is preferred but will consider relevant work experience.
  • Capable of operating Microsoft Office applications, including Excel, Word, and PowerPoint.
  • Ability to communicate with employees, co-workers, volunteers, management staff, and guests in a clear, business-like, and respectful manner that focuses on generating a positive, enthusiastic, and cooperative work environment.
  • Ability to work well in a team-oriented, fast-paced, event-driven environment.
  • Possess a valid food handling certificate or alcohol service permit if required by state or federal regulations.
  • Ability to handle cash accurately and responsibly.
  • Ability to calculate basic math functions (addition, subtraction, multiplication, division, percentages) as they relate to POS cash/credit transactions, cash reconciliation, and product inventory.
